Meet Gerald McDermott, Caldecott Medalist, illustrator and author of many award-winning picture books based on folklore and mythology.
Awarded the Caldecott Medal for ARROW TO THE SUN, as well as Caldecott
Honors for ANANSI THE SPIDER and RAVEN, he has made a unique contribution
to contemporary children's literature. Through his bold, graphic renderings
of timeless tales from around the world, McDermott communicates his deep
understanding of the transformative power of myth. View his work, past and
present, and learn more about his life and his current projects.
